Synthesis and Application of Polycarboxylate Superlasticizer with Viscosity-reducing and Low Shrinkage Capability

Shan-Shan QIAN, Hai-Dong JIANG, Bei DING, Yi WANG, Chun-Yang ZHENG

Abstract


A low shrinkage and viscosity-reducing type polycarboxylate superplasticizer was synthesized with maleic anhydride (MAH), diethylene glycol monobutyl ether (DGBE) and methoxypoly (ethylene glycol) methacrylate (MPEGnMA). The surface tension, early shrinkage of concrete, cement paste and application performance in concrete (slump spread, T50, V-funnel) were measured. The results show that the polycarboxylate superplasticizer we prepared has good low shrinkage and excellent viscosity-reducing capability for concrete.
